PCM Clicking and Dead battery

Hi,

My fiancee went to start my f150 today and said it wouldn't start due to a dead battery. I went to look at it and found a dead battery but the PCM relay (Relay #2) was also continuously clicking. I could not start the truck and ended up having to jump start it. I was able to get the clicking to stop before I jumped it by pressing on the brake for several seconds. I'm not sure if the relay clicking in was a result of the dead battery and her trying to start it or if it started the problem. It didn't look like the lights were left on so I was thinking the PCM had something to do with the dead battery.

Usually when you have a rundown battery, and clicking relays, it's because the voltage is so low in the system. You can also get this with the starter relay and a dead battery or bad battery cable.

What happens is with no load, the voltage from the battery will rise up. Any load on the battery, because it's charge is very low, will cause the voltage in the system to drop.

So the PCM relay is off, the load on the system is low. When the PCM is activated, it sends power to all the computer circuits. This is a heavier load that the dead battery can't handle, so the voltage drops. The voltage dropping causes the coil in the PCM relay to drop out. Of course when the PCM relay drops out, the load on the battery goes away, and the voltage rises. When the voltage rises, the coil in the PCM relay kicks in again, and you go through the same cycle over and over. That is what the clicking is all about.
